    Also, if you are a freshman, you must first understand the composition of the scholarship before you can make your own plan. Generally speaking, the evaluation of the scholarship includes final grades + certificate + on-campus activities, if you hold a position in the school, there are also extra points, and the higher the position, the more points.

    There are a lot of university scholarships, such as national scholarships are very difficult to get, there may only be 1-2 in a department, but the school-level scholarship is still very easy to get, as long as the students are among the best and the comprehensive quality is up to standard, it is very simple to get the school-level scholarship.

    1.Must have an excellent academic record.

    Studying in college is not like studying in high school, where there is supervision by teachers and parents, but you can't slack off. Because if you want to get a scholarship, maintaining excellent grades is the most important thing. Because in the comprehensive assessment score of the scholarship, the grade accounts for a large proportion.

    2.You must not skip class.

    University management is not very strict, students skipping classes abound, teachers generally adopt a roll call system, and the teacher verifies that he has skipped class, and he will fail the course twice in a row (three times in some schools), even if it is once, it will be greatly discounted in the teacher's impression, and eventually lead to a low impression score.

    3.You must not fail the course, once you fail the course, you will not be able to get a scholarship.

    4.Participate in events and competitions.

    5.Elected class officers and student council officers.

    University scholarships are awarded once per academic year. Most schools do it once a year, and there are no classes to do graduation projects in the second semester of the senior year of undergraduates, so the freshman to junior year is one academic year, that is, the first semester and the first semester: the senior year only has the first semester, so it is only evaluated according to the grades of the previous semester.

    This is the majority of schools, and some schools only select for 3 years, but not in the senior year.

    2What are the college scholarships.

    The maximum national scholarship is 8,000 yuan; National Inspirational Scholarship 5,000 yuan.

    The living expenses of the scholarship and the one-time placement subsidy are as follows:

    Undergraduate Scholarship Living Allowance: 800 RMB per person per monthPostgraduate ScholarshipLiving Allowance: 1,100 RMB per person per month.

    Doctoral Scholarship Living Allowance: RMB 1,400 per person per month.

    Living allowance for Chinese language scholar scholarship: 800 RMB per person per month (1,100 RMB per month for each person with a university degree or above).

    Scholarship for General Scholars Living Expenses: RMB 1,100 per person per monthLiving expenses for Senior Scholar Scholarship: RMB 1,400 per person per month.

    Students with the above-mentioned scholarships who have completed one academic year will receive a one-time placement subsidy of 600 yuan at the time of admission; Students who study for less than one academic year will be given a one-time placement subsidy of 300 yuan at the time of enrollment.
